Magnificent! Mid Century Modern Red Mahogany Finish Corner Table In the manner of Paul McCobb 30" by 30" by 26" Wow! This is an incredible find! A gorgeous red mahogany mid century corner table! So sleek and so practical! In the mid century period homes were getting smaller and furniture started accommodating tighter spaces with innovative designs! Corner tables that didn't get in the way were a new staple in Manhattan penthouses and apartments! Smaller suburban homes used them to great effect as well! They could hold a lamp, plant or whatever one needed. They were incredibly practical and at the same time as modern as tomorrow! This example has an amazing and incredibly rare red mahogany finish! It looks simply stunning and has survived the past 65 years with only light age wear! Legs are removable and will be removed for super safe shipping. FURNITURE OF LEGENDS! HOWARD VERBECK 19TH CENTURY FRENCH LOUIS XVI MARBLE SIDE TABLE! DIMENSIONS: APPROX. 18" WIDE & 20" TALL Some furniture is more than just furniture. Some furnishings are an intricate part of history and stories accompany them that make them larger than life. Howard Verbeck was one of the greatest interior decorators to the celebrities in Los Angeles. Verbeck had married a noted opera singer and had connections to anyone who mattered in early LA. He was responsible for the amazingly rich "look" of Los Angeles homes and fledgling Hollywood in the roaring twenties! He was the father of "Hollywood Regency" style - which was then really just high end European furnishings of the most famous styles and periods. From Valentino to Douglas Fairbanks many silent screen stars home were furnished by Verbeck and he became extremely wealthy. Verbeck purchased one of the most famous homes in LA from a grain tycoon. On his birthday, he had the house removed from its foundation and taken to a new location. For four hours the house moved down Wilshire Boulevard in two sections on many slow moving trucks. What made it an LA legend was that he had a huge party in the house as it was moved! Even the mayor attended and the party symbolized the excess of the roaring twenties and Los Angeles high society just before the depression. This table still has Howard Verbeck's signature nameplate affixed! Verbeck, when decorating celebrities homes would travel to Europe and bring back a small inventory of superb pieces. In these days, travel to Europe was by ship and time consuming. The Louis XVI style French table is one he had brought over for a celebrity client. It still has his plate, the manufacturer's label number and was embossed and stamped "Made in France" so it could be exported. The Louis XVI style is timeless and this table features a marble top, inlaid woodwork and brass details that identify its superior European craftsmanship.
